Clinical Research Director

What Does a Professional in this Career Do?

A Clinical Research Director is responsible for the overall research strategy of an organization undertaking clinical trials, usually pharmacological drug testing.

Education and Experience

Posted Clinical Research Director jobs typically require the following level of education. The numbers below are based on job postings in the United States from the past year. Not all job postings list education requirements.

Education LevelPercentage
Associate's Degree0%
Bachelor's Degree43.57%
Master's Degree46.89%
Doctoral Degree49.79%
Other1.76%

Posted Clinical Research Director jobs typically require the following number of years of experience. The numbers below are based on job postings in the United States from the past year. Not all job postings list experience requirements.

Years of ExperiencePercentage
0 to 2 years4.8%
3 to 5 years48.73%
6 to 8 years20.06%
9+ years26.41%
